Output 5abff27cecf28584ef6ddcb6eac312eda8b2db383ad4d0efcabe7c46dbbea403:1

value
209990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5593fdc144fdc8e54aa7c6ef2657d86abd14734 OP_EQUALVERIFY OP_CHECKSIG
address
1Mugf6D5YTrGDJBi3Ao5sK1JEAwEpe6u3a
transaction
5abff27cecf28584ef6ddcb6eac312eda8b2db383ad4d0efcabe7c46dbbea403
confirmations
628419
spent
true